OPPEGÅRD

Province : Viken (until 2020 Akershus)
Incorporated into : 2020 Nordre Follo

Coat of arms (crest) of Oppegård
Official blazon
Norwegian

I svart 17 gull traingler - 5.5.3.3.1.

English blazon wanted

Origin/meaning

The arms were granted on August 6, 1976.

The arms show 17 triangles, one for each of the medieval farms that were in the municipality.
